滨州开发金融系统:时间几何与实施之法
金融系统作为金融机构运行与金融市场发展的关键支撑,其开发对于滨州市优化金融服务、提升金融效率、推动金融创新意义重大。然而,开发一套适配滨州当地经济金融特色的金融系统,面临着时间规划与实施方法的重要考量。
开发所需时间预估
开发金融系统所需的时间并非固定不变,而是受到多种因素的综合影响。
系统功能的复杂度
若要开发一套基础的金融系统,仅涵盖基本的账户管理、交易记录查询等功能,开发周期可能相对较短。一般来说,在人员配备充足、技术成熟的情况下,大约需要6 – 9个月。这期间包括需求分析与设计约1 – 2个月、系统开发3 – 5个月、测试与调试1 – 2个月。但如果要构建一个功能复杂、全面的金融系统,如包含风险评估模型、智能投顾、跨境金融交易等功能,开发难度将大幅增加。这种情况下,开发时间可能延长至18 – 24个月甚至更久。因为复杂功能的实现需要进行大量的算法研究、数据采集与处理,以及与外部系统的对接和调试。
数据迁移与整合
滨州市金融机构可能已经积累了大量的历史数据,在开发新金融系统时,需要将这些数据迁移到新系统中,并进行整合和清洗。数据量的大小、数据的质量以及数据的格式都会影响迁移和整合的时间。如果数据量较小且质量较高,迁移和整合工作可能在3 – 6个月内完成;但如果数据存在大量错误、缺失或格式不统一的问题,可能需要6 – 12个月甚至更长时间来处理。
法规与合规要求
金融行业受到严格的法规监管,开发金融系统必须确保符合相关法规要求。滨州市金融系统开发也不例外,需要投入时间进行法规研究、系统合规性设计和测试。随着金融法规的不断更新和完善,合规工作的难度和时间成本也在增加。一般来说,合规工作可能需要3 – 6个月的时间,以确保系统在安全、隐私、反洗钱等方面符合法规标准。
系统开发的实施方法
前期规划与需求调研
在开发金融系统之前,滨州市相关部门和金融机构应组成联合调研小组,深入了解金融市场需求、金融机构业务流程以及客户的期望。通过与银行、证券、保险等金融机构的沟通,收集业务需求和痛点,制定系统开发的详细规划。同时,要对国内外先进的金融系统进行研究和借鉴,结合滨州本地实际情况,确定系统的功能架构和技术选型。
选择合适的开发团队
开发金融系统需要专业的技术团队,包括软件开发工程师、数据分析师、金融专家等。滨州市可以通过两种方式组建开发团队:一是内部培养和组建团队,选拔和培训本地金融机构和科技企业的技术人员;二是与外部专业的金融科技公司合作,借助其丰富的开发经验和技术实力。在选择外部合作方时,要对其资质、信誉、技术能力等进行严格评估,确保项目的顺利进行。
采用敏捷开发方法
敏捷开发是一种迭代、渐进的开发方法,适合金融系统这种需求变化频繁、开发周期较长的项目。在开发过程中,将项目划分为多个短周期的迭代,每个迭代都有明确的目标和交付成果。通过不断与用户沟通和反馈,及时调整开发方向和功能需求,提高开发效率和系统的适应性。同时,要建立有效的项目管理机制,确保项目进度、质量和成本的可控。
加强数据安全与风险管理
金融系统涉及大量的敏感数据,如客户账户信息、交易记录等,数据安全至关重要。在开发过程中,要采用先进的加密技术、访问控制技术和数据备份恢复技术,确保数据的保密性、完整性和可用性。同时,要建立完善的风险管理体系,对系统开发过程中的技术风险、市场风险、合规风险等进行全面评估和监控,及时采取措施进行防范和应对。
系统测试与上线
在系统开发完成后,要进行全面的测试,包括功能测试、性能测试、安全测试等,确保系统的稳定性和可靠性。可以先在内部进行小范围的试点运行,收集用户反馈,对系统进行优化和改进。在试点运行成功后,再逐步扩大上线范围,最终实现系统的全面上线。上线后,要建立持续的运维和监控机制,及时处理系统出现的问题,保障系统的正常运行。
滨州市开发金融系统是一项复杂而长期的工程,需要充分考虑开发时间的不确定性和各种影响因素,采用科学合理的实施方法。通过精心规划、专业团队的努力和有效的管理,有望在合理的时间内开发出一套符合滨州金融发展需求的先进金融系统,为滨州市的经济发展提供有力的金融支持。